St. Elizabeth Catholic Charities
Position Title: Agency Director
Status: Full-time, exempt
Secretariat: Se Catholic Charities and Family Ministries
Reports to: Secretary for Catholic Charities and Family Ministries
Supervises: Leadership Team
Primary Function: Oversees and administers all the functions of St. Elizabeth Catholic Charities New Albany
Position Content
M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ND REGULAR ACTIVITIES
- Work closely with the Agency Council to achieve the mission of Catholic Charities
- Provide leadership and oversight to existing programs, services and activities to ensure that program objectives are met in a fiscally responsible manner
- Serve as chief spokesperson for the agency, providing strong leadership and representation of the agency to constituencies including Advisory Council, staff, donors and prospects, government, funders and the community, so as to enhance the public profile of the agency
- Communicate with deanery parish pastoral leadership as needed
- Identify emerging areas of need in the service community. Envision and recommend new, fundable programs and services to the Agency Council and Secretary for Catholic Charities.
- Work with the Agency Council to prioritize needs and continue to develop a strategic plan.
- Provide motivation, leadership, direction, and oversight to agency staff in a manner that is collaborative and supportive
- Nurture positive relationships with state and local governments to effectively advocate for the needs of children and families, and successfully negotiate adequate funding of services
- Ensure fiscal accountability of programs and services; lead the agency in utilization of financial resources to strengthen its internal structure and service delivery
- Work in collaboration with the agency development director on the fundraising efforts of the agency. Develop relationships with donors, oversee grant proposals and applications. Work with the Advisory Council on the development and implementation of development / fund raising events
- Continue to develop quality improvement tracking measures that will support quality service delivery. Work with the Social Services Director to drive a continuous improvement cultural throughout the agency utilizing the PQI process.
- Oversee personnel and personnel issues, including salaries, benefits, and staff selection
- Provide staff forum for intra-agency communication, e.g., staff and departmental meeting
- Assists and approves the development of the annual agency budget.
- Other duties as assigned by the Secretary for Catholic Charities
Position Specifications/Requirements
Skills, Knowledge, and/or Abilities
- Agency Director shall be Roman Catholic in good standing with the Church with a deep appreciation for the Church’s social teaching and its relevance to agency mission
- Leadership experience in a direct-service organization
- Strong sense of vision. Demonstrated ability to communicate vision to inspire and motivate others
- Enthusiasm and skills necessary to actively participate in funding development activities
- Ability to think creatively and make strategic decisions
- Confident, open leadership and management style that promotes teamwork and accountability
- Strong verbal and written communication skills
- Strong presentation skills
- Inspirational leadership ability, sincerity and ability to build trust and consensus
Education, Training, and Experience
- Licensed MSW, or graduate degree in related field – or commensurate experience
- Understanding of budgets and fiscal management
- Minimum of five years’ management experience, including program management
- Community relations experience
- Development experience desired
- Experience with social services is a plus
- Assess for risk and risk prevention
Working Environment
- May need to work some evenings and weekends
- Need to work with a variety of organizations, including the media, community organizations, etc.
- Intra-state travel required
- There is access to confidential information that must be safeguarded
